This project is crucial for establishing a citywide asset management program built on a unified geospatial environment. The primary goal is to capture and manage infrastructure asset data across multiple programs, including various Public Works Department (PWD) assets such as sidewalks, roadways, green infrastructure, utility cuts, and Public Improvement Commission (PIC) items. Through this contract, the City seeks to build geospatial layers utilizing a City-owned instance of ESRI ArcGIS. The aim is to create comprehensive layers and a dashboard to inventory physical assets and facilitate the collection, analysis, and reporting of asset condition data on an annual basis. The specific assets requiring individual layers are: pavement, sidewalk, pavement markings, PIC, green infrastructure, and utility cuts in the public way.
